Nathan is on track to more than double his business this year and can track that growth down to a couple of big things. The first being knowing where the problems are, and addressing them with his team. In order to do that, a lot of smaller steps are involved, including listening to your team. Nathan Brooks Real Estate Background: -Owner of Bridge Turn Key Investments -Flips about 150 properties a year, providing exceptionally high quality turn key properties -Recently started their own retail real estate team -Based in Kansas City, Kansas -Say hi to him at https://www.bridgeturnkey.com/
